Let me clarify about the area. This isn't Canada where you can get lost 50 meters into the woods and have no clue where you are.
Much of the area is open land, there are woods too, with hiking paths and mountain bike paths and in summer there are many hikers. There are mountain refuges with food and sleeping areas, there are small villages with shops, like the shop where JF would allegedly have been seen.
Mobile network is good and should you get stuck or lost, you can call the rescue services. (European code is 112.)
This is no wilderness.
I've been following the latest news about the rescue services and most accidents involve sprained or broken ankles. People fall off the mountains too, one elderly gentleman died.
There are a few missing persons in the area, two of them have been missing for years, one other missing woman was found deceased after a number of days. As far as I could see, they went missing when they left their homes, and they might have gone anywhere.
JF is an exception, he was on a specific track with a clear goal, and he documented his journey.
If JF had become desoriented, he might have walked through the meadows, the woods or the rocks for a while, but ultimately he would find a path and after a while, he would also find other hikers, or other hikers would find him.
Parts of the trail are risky, especially in case of a fall. These stages have been searched in detail and he wasn't found. Could he have fallen into a crevice that no one has noticed? Anything is possible. Is it likely? Not so sure.
The other option is that JF is hiding in plain sight. Something happened that left him confused and he is walking on and sleeping rough. He has some cash, so he can buy food. He could be literally anywhere. On the track on his way to Italy, or anywhere in Europe. One of the possibilities is a hospital.
Analyzing where his mobile phone last pinged and on which towers might help.
